History of Zanjan: A Rich Past to Present
Zanjan, with a history dating back to the pre-Christian era, is one of Iran’s ancient and significant cities. It was strategically located on the trade route from Ray to Azerbaijan, playing a critical role in cultural and economic exchanges. Founded by Ardashir I, Zanjan has witnessed various historical periods since its establishment. During the Qajar era, Zanjan was recognized as the capital of Iran’s metal handicrafts due to its industrial and artisanal activities. The Soltaniyeh Dome, one of Zanjan’s historical symbols, reflects the grandeur of Islamic architecture and the city’s historical significance. Zanjan’s Climate: Diversity That Makes Each Season Special
Zanjan’s climate is influenced by mountainous conditions, experiencing four distinct seasons. In spring, temperatures are mild, and Zanjan’s nature reaches its peak beauty with blossoming flowers. Summers are hot and dry, but the mountainous areas boast fresh and clean air. Autumn displays a beautiful landscape with leaves changing to warm and pleasing colors, and the cold, snowy winters offer perfect conditions for winter activities such as skiing and mountain climbing. Attractions in Zanjan: From Architecture to Nature
Zanjan, with a variety of attractions, draws every type of tourist. The Soltaniyeh Dome, with its tall architecture and beautiful brickwork, is one of the most important historical sites in the city, offering an unforgettable visiting experience. The Grand Mosque of Zanjan, with its beautiful design and rich history, is another must-visit location. Kataleh Khor Cave, one of Iran’s largest and most beautiful caves, offers an extraordinary experience for caving enthusiasts with its unique stalactites and multiple levels. Beyond these, Zanjan’s colorful mountains and natural valleys offer excellent opportunities for hiking and enjoying natural views. Souvenirs of Zanjan: A Symbol of Iran’s Art and Culture
Zanjan, with its diverse handicrafts, offers an excellent opportunity to purchase unique souvenirs. Zanjan’s famous handled knives, known for their high quality and beautiful designs, are among the city’s most popular souvenirs. Filigree work, with its diverse patterns and colors, provides a beautiful and charming gift for art and handicraft enthusiasts. Additionally, traditional sweets such as rice bread and Shasti pastries are popular souvenirs, offering delightful flavors with their distinct recipes.
